Menu Item Price Comparison

10 items

Shared menu items ranked by largest price difference between Pashazade and Chief

# Menu Item Pashazade Chief Price Gap
1 Adana Kebab $14.00 $4.50 $9.50
2 Shish Kebab $15.25 $7.00 $8.25
3 Sucuklu Pide $12.50 $7.00 $5.50
4 Chicken Kebab $12.50 $7.00 $5.50
5 Iskender Kebab $14.95 $11.00 $3.95
6 Falafel $2.25 $5.00 $-2.75
7 Kunefe $6.00 $4.00 $2.00
8 Eggplant Salad $5.50 $4.00 $1.50
9 Baklava $4.00 $3.00 $1.00
10 Lahmacun $2.75 $2.50 $0.25
